John Cena WWE Return Match Revealed

You're not going to like this!

John Cena is scheduled to defend the United States title against Sheamus on the December 26 house show at Madison Square Garden. This will be Cena's first match after temporarily leaving WWE following this Sunday's Hell In A Cell show. Also announced for the show, is Kevin Owens versus Dean Ambrose with the Intercontinental title on the line. Cards are always subject to change, but they do sometimes reflect the feuds that are pencilled in. Ambrose and Owens sounds like fun, but Cena and Sheamus? That's a feud destined to die a boring death. It has been done before, and it is almost like WWE are trolling the fans by booking it. Notice as well, the Garden is advertising Cena to be defending his US title. That could just be a swerve, it could be updated at a later date, or maybe it is an indication that WWE are just going to leave the belt on Cena for the next two months. They did that with Brock Lesnar's WWE Title reign, so it isn't inconceivable that they'd allow Cena to stay champ when away from TV. The other thing that could be going on, is Sheamus is the challenger at Hell In A Cell and wins the belt. Cena then returns and feuds with him in December. As the advertising stands right now, a Cena Sheamus narrative is what WWE are going with.
